Collapsing Glomerulopathy Superimposed on Diabetic Nephropathy

Diabetic nephropathy (DN) can be complicated by collapsing glomerulopathy (CG), a severe kidney disease. This rare combination can lead to rapid progression to end-stage renal disease, even with conservative treatment.
Area of Science:
- Nephrology
- Pathology
Background:
- Diabetic nephropathy (DN) is a common complication of diabetes, leading to progressive kidney failure.
- Nondiabetic kidney diseases can coexist with DN, altering its course and prognosis.
- Collapsing glomerulopathy (CG) is a severe glomerular injury associated with rapid progression and poor outcomes.
Observation:
- A patient with established diabetic nephropathy presented with massive proteinuria and rapid decline in renal function.
- Renal biopsy revealed features of collapsing glomerulopathy superimposed on diabetic nephropathy.
- The patient received conservative management for the condition.
Findings:
- The coexistence of collapsing glomerulopathy and diabetic nephropathy was diagnosed.
- The superimposed collapsing glomerulopathy significantly accelerated the progression of kidney disease.
Implications:
- This case highlights the potential for severe, rapid progression when collapsing glomerulopathy complicates diabetic nephropathy.
- Recognizing this rare association is crucial for accurate diagnosis and prognosis in patients with diabetic nephropathy and worsening proteinuria.
- Further research into the mechanisms and management of this combined condition is warranted.
